Output 777e8226c6318474af02c787a7a271d141c08775986c323ea985fb09732996a9:0

value
18039293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ac92651acbd85b62cdcd789b4e7645fbada1bd22 OP_EQUAL
address
3HRVXEih6amaGM3ypKhoxFma6rmmWx5XEL
transaction
777e8226c6318474af02c787a7a271d141c08775986c323ea985fb09732996a9
confirmations
159785
spent
true